-4

1345を配列で表示したい
[0] => 1 [1] => 3 [2] => 4 [3] => 5

forループの使用を考えていますが、何もしません。助けてください

$a = 1345;
for ($i=1; $i<=4; $i++)
 {
echo $a%10 . "<br>";
 }
4

5 に答える 5

1

Idはそれを文字列に変換し、str_splitを実行します

于 2013-02-26T21:08:10.067 に答える
1

Try this:

var_dump(array(1, 3, 4, 5));
于 2013-02-26T21:08:00.333 に答える
0

var_dump()を使用するのはどうですか?

<?php
$a = array(1, 2, array("a", "b", "c"));
ob_start();
var_dump($a);
$result = ob_get_clean();
?>

結果:

array(3) {
  [0]=>
  int(1)
  [1]=>
  int(2)
  [2]=>
  array(3) {
    [0]=>
    string(1) "a"
    [1]=>
    string(1) "b"
    [2]=>
    string(1) "c"
  }
}

http://php.net/manual/es/function.var-dump.php

于 2013-02-26T21:09:08.997 に答える
0
$a = array(1,3,4,5);
foreach($a as $value){
    echo $value;
}

あなたはあなたの質問を変え続けます、str_split()それは現在の質問への答えです。

于 2013-02-26T21:09:34.980 に答える
0
print_r(array(1,3,4,5));

この男だけ

于 2013-02-26T21:13:55.347 に答える